What is Evening Skiing?

Night winter sports describes snowboarding or snowboarding on slopes that are artificially lit in the evening. This activity enables enthusiasts to appreciate wintertime sporting activities after daytime hours, expanding their time on the inclines beyond the typical hours of procedure. Several ski resorts around the globe have actually accepted this trend, providing illuminated runs for those seeking an exhilarating experience when most individuals are unwinding for the evening.

The History of Evening Skiing

Night winter sports traces its origins back to Europe in the mid-20th century. Some resorts started trying out flood lamps during nighttime hours to fit ski enthusiasts who couldn't hit the inclines throughout daylight due to work commitments. By the 1970s, night skiing was obtaining grip in The United States and Canada, with resorts like Mont Tremblant in Canada leading the charge. Today, numerous ski locations across continents have embraced this thrilling addition.
